问题:在做项目时,我们经常会遇到,通过某个点击事件或其他事件时更新了某项数据,但是通过异步获取更新后的数据时,会发现通过普通监听事件的列的数据又变成了未处理状态。(例如:时间戳的转换)这时,我们需要Vue的深度监听事件,以上一篇文章为例( https://blog.youkuaiyun.com/weixin_42342164/article/details/103037592 ),其他事件需要异步请求刷新界面时,时间就变成了时间戳。
解决方法:Vue的深度监听。(以上一篇文章为基础,进行小改动即可)
1.查看Vue的基本项是否有没有
2.检查javaScript内的代码声明。需要var app 在new Vue内声明el,data,methods。以及数据监听watch的书写。
3.methods内的时间戳转换为正常日期的函数。